New home construction is often...I don't think 40k a year can afford a 350k (not that some don't try..see the housing bubble) house. A $350K house, 20% down, 30 years, 4.5% is $836/month. $40K/year is $3300/month, before taxes. Maximum recommended debt to income ratio is 0.28 times annual income, or $933 month.Construction loans cover the cost of building or rehabilitating a house. Basic carpentry skills are essential.It costs $376,900 on average to build a home in New Jersey. This figure can add up to $526,900 if you include land costs, excavations, permits, and other expenses. A new home construction can take up to 9 to 12 months. Whereas you can buy a home in New Jersey for $495,200 (median sale price as of September 2023) in 1.5 to 2 months.The price per square foot to build a house in Louisiana averages $95 to $141, which is $237,500 to $352,500 for a 2,500-square-foot house. But costs vary widely according to your location, land costs, style, size, and materials. So, if your ... toilet auger vs snake Step 9: The foundation is poured in this construction step to build a new house. Your home will have one of three types of foundation: slab foundation. a crawlspace. a full basement poured or constructed. The concrete is cured to reach maximum strength, taking anywhere from 28 to 60 days based on weather conditions.Day 1: Build the door (Steps 2-10). Take your project anywhere with you Find inspiration to furnish and decorate your home in 3D or create your project on the go with the mobile app! Aug 16, 2022 · Size of the Storm Shelter. FEMA recommends that you make your storm shelter a minimum of 7 square feet per person for tornadoes. For hurricanes (which last longer than tornadoes), you should calculate at least 10 square feet per person. venus pubic hair and skinhow do i clear cache on my mac Step 2.
